Rothwell, North Northamptonshire, England, UK; Reported: December 3, 2007

Date of Sighting: No Firm Date

Location of Sighting: Rothwell/Kettering, Northamptonshire

Brief Description of sighting: The object was definitely unusual and was a possible UFO sighting. (Message taken – 3 December 2007).

Source link

Leave A Reply

Your email address will not be published.